Abstract
This paper describes the use of two pseudorandom noise generators designed by Wolf and Bilger (1977) to generate repeatable samples of noise with sinusoidally rippled amplitude spectra. A description is given of the interface necessary to program the generator using a laboratory computer. Small modifications to the original generators are required. Sample output spectra are also shown.
